Possible Causes of Carpet Water Damage

Water damage to carpets in Spring Valley can stem from a variety of sources. Often, heavy rainfall or flooding can lead to overwhelmed drainage systems, causing water to seep into homes and saturate carpets. Additionally, plumbing failures such as broken pipes or leaking fixtures can introduce significant moisture into living spaces, resulting in waterlogged carpets.

Another common cause includes appliance malfunctions, like washing machines or water heaters bursting or leaking. These incidents can happen unexpectedly, creating urgent need for professional water damage restoration. No matter the cause, prompt action is crucial to prevent further damage and mold growth, which can compromise indoor air quality and your health.

How Our Experts Can Fix That

Our team begins by thoroughly assessing the extent of water intrusion and identifying the source to prevent further damage. We then quickly implement water extraction techniques to remove standing water from your carpets, ensuring a dry environment that inhibits mold growth.

Following extraction, we utilize advanced drying equipment such as industrial air movers and dehumidifiers to eliminate residual moisture. Our specialists carefully monitor the drying process to ensure your carpets are adequately dried without causing additional damage or warping.

Once the carpets are dry, we inspect them for any signs of deterioration or persistent moisture pockets. If needed, we conduct thorough cleaning and deodorizing to eliminate any residual odors or contaminants, restoring your carpets to a fresh, clean state. How long does carpet drying take after water damage?

The drying time varies depending on the extent of water intrusion, carpet thickness, and ventilation.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few hours to a couple of days. Our team closely monitors the process to ensure thorough drying and prevent mold growth.

Will my carpet need to be replaced after water damage?

Not necessarily. Many carpets can be salvaged if dried promptly and properly cleaned. We assess the damage carefully to determine whether cleaning and restoration are sufficient or if replacement is necessary to ensure safety and hygiene.

How can I prevent water damage to my carpets in the future?

Regular maintenance and inspections of plumbing, appliances, and gutters can help prevent leaks. Installing water sensors and ensuring proper drainage around your property also reduces the risk.
